Sreenath Bhasi, a well-known malayalam actor, was detained for reportedly verbally insulting an anchor. According to rumours, Sreenath was promoting his soon-to-be-released movie Chattambi. He allegedly verbally attacked the female anchor and the YouTube channel's camera crew during this. Last week, the female journalist reported anything to the police. On Friday, september 23, the kochi police reported the incident.

Sreenath had gone to the police station with his attorney after learning about the case. Cops nabbed him as soon as he entered the police station. Later, bail was used to release Sreenath. The police are gathering information and conducting an investigation. Where the event occurred during the interview, CCTV footage and other types of proof are being obtained.

In the meantime, Sreenath had already engaged in similar impolite behaviour. He had previously insulted a radio host while conducting an interview, and the old video had gone viral online. Sreenath's poor behaviour has been criticised by online users. Sreenath began his career as a radio host. His performance in movies like Da Thadiya, Trance, Kappela, and bheeshma Parvam helped him become well-known. This incident has caused ripples on social media and the video is going viral as well.
